dc.description.abstract In this study, we aimed to investigate whether the procedure and product kinetics differ according to age groups in advanced-age MM patients who underwent autologous HSCT. 59 patients who underwent autologous HSCT were retrospectively analyzed. Then, the patients were divided into two groups as 60-65 years and >= 65 years. It was significantly lower in >= 65 years group (p=0.008) and proportionally, the procedure duration was also significantly shortened in this group (p=0.013). Total number of collected CD34 positive stem cells was 6.20 x 106 (+/- 3.83) in 60-65 years group while it was 5.51 x 106 (+/- 2.48) in >= 65 years group with no statistically significant difference. (p=0.825). In conclusion, there was no significant difference in terms of the number of collected CD34-positive stem cells in this study that investigates the mobilization data, procedure and product kinetics, we think that successful stem cell mobilization can be performed in appropriately selected patients regardless of age.
